Consumer — a hidden tradition —

Consumers break the taboo against eating the flesh of the fallen. Eating the body parts of their slain foes lets them gain a measure of their power and knowledge. Some consumers see absorbing the potency of the defeated as the fastest way to power, some are driven by long-ago trauma that manifests as a compulsion to dine upon their enemies, while others simply lack the empathy to understand why such an act repulses most right-thinking people.

To choose this expert path, you must be a living creature that can eat.

Body Part Benefits

  • Blood. At the end of each hour, you automatically heal damage equal to the Power score of the creature you consumed (minimum 1).
  • Bone. You gain a +1 bonus to Defense.
  • Brain. You speak all languages known by the creature you consumed. As well, you gain access to some of the creature’s memories, which grants you 1 boon on Intellect challenge rolls.
  • Eyes. You make all Perception rolls with 1 boon. In addition, if the dead creature had shadowsight, darksight, or truesight traits, you gain the trait.
  • Flesh. You gain a bonus to Health equal to your group level.
  • Heart. If the creature could cast spells, choose one spell the creature knew whose rank is equal to or less than your Power score. You gain one casting of that spell.
  • Liver. You gain one of the creature’s immunities.
  • Tongue. In social situations, you make attack rolls with 1 boon. You can speak all languages the dead creature spoke, and can imitate its voice, call, song, or other vocalizations perfectly.
